Job description

The Manager, AI-Native Quality Engineering leads a team focused on improving software quality through AI-powered test automation, regression efficiency, and release quality practices. This role is expected to actively drive the use of AI tools to design, build, maintain, and execute automated tests across API, UI, integration, and end-to-end workflows.

The ideal candidate is a player-coach who can lead a team while staying close to the work. They will evaluate and implement AI tools that improve automated test creation, test maintenance, execution efficiency, defect analysis, and regression effectiveness, while also strengthening release readiness and overall quality outcomes. This role partners closely with Engineering, Product, DevOps, and Release stakeholders to improve software delivery and build confidence in product quality.

Position Responsibilities:

Team Leadership and People Management
- Manage, coach, and develop a team of quality engineers, automation engineers, and testers
- Set team priorities, goals, and expectations aligned to delivery and quality outcomes
- Support career development, performance management, and skill growth across modern quality engineering practices
- Foster a culture of accountability, continuous improvement, collaboration, and practical execution

AI-Powered Test Automation
- Drive the use of AI tools to design, generate, maintain, and execute automated tests across API, UI, integration, and end-to-end workflows
- Evaluate and implement AI-assisted capabilities that improve automation speed, coverage, stability, and maintainability
- Help establish practical standards and guardrails for the responsible use of AI in automated test development, execution, and defect analysis
- Help the team use AI to reduce repetitive manual work and improve automation effectiveness across the full test lifecycle
- Guide the application of AI to regression optimization, defect triage, failure analysis, and test maintenance

Automation and Quality Engineering
- Lead improvements to automated test frameworks and coverage across API, UI, integration, and end-to-end testing
- Stay hands-on with automation design, AI-assisted test generation, framework decisions, and workflow improvements
- Improve regression strategy by using AI and automation to better align test execution with product risk, release timelines, and quality goals
- Partner with engineers to embed AI-enabled automation and quality practices earlier in the development lifecycle
- Improve test reliability, maintainability, and signal quality to support faster and more confident delivery
